    Peninsula Integrative Medicine is a holistic healthcare practice that genuinely cares about its patients. The doctors take a thorough and compassionate approach, providing personalized recommendations to nourish and improve overall well-being. Rather than just prescribing medications, they focus on identifying and addressing the root causes of health concerns. Patients appreciate the unhurried appointments, detailed explanations, and customized plans tailored to their specific needs. The practice offers a partnership in wellness, with doctors who are knowledgeable, caring, and responsive. With the added convenience of zoom visits and pediatric care, Peninsula Integrative Medicine is a trusted and recommended healthcare destination.
